Most gas, electric, and solar storage hot water systems come with a sacrificial anode rod inside the steel cylinder to prevent rust and corrosion. This rod works through the process of electrolysis, gradually depleting over time to protect the system.
To maximise the lifespan of your hot water system, it’s essential to replace the anode regularly. Typically, anodes require replacement every 3 to 5 years, depending on the system's age, condition, and the hardness of your water, which can significantly impact the anode's lifespan.

An anode is a sacrificial metal rod inserted into your hot water system to protect the tank from corrosion. Over time, the anode corrodes instead of your tank, extending the lifespan of your hot water system.
-
Anodes typically need replacement every 4–6 years, depending on your water quality and the type of anode used. Regular replacement ensures optimal protection for your tank.
-
Signs include unusual noises from the tank, rusty or discoloured water, a metallic smell in hot water, or reduced hot water efficiency. Routine inspections can identify anode wear before problems arise.
-
By replacing the anode regularly, you prevent premature corrosion of your hot water system, reducing the likelihood of costly repairs or the need for a new tank.
